I'm old enough that the first thing that the word "thongs" brings to my mind is footwear. When I was a kid, we didn't wear flip flops, we wore thongs. After 30 or so years of hearing "thong" referring to underwear for men or women, I'm finally to the point where I don't first think of footwear.
